Output 5268877e4a035088a45e067e7830f14e304a633880081d0ba9f272ad63038d81:3

value
349430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63d4a9c13cabf6ae95a79ecf72a138077c6abbba OP_EQUAL
address
3AnsadHuBYrTYHwgiVSajQEdHPW5eXk5Lg
transaction
5268877e4a035088a45e067e7830f14e304a633880081d0ba9f272ad63038d81
spent
true